TTT: Cello, 10 foods, and crazy ideas

December 15, 2011 by MCM Mama 11 Comments

1.  Last night was Jones’ winter concert.  He started playing the cello this fall, so we got to attend the annual band, orchestra, and chorus concert.  The concert was surprisingly good.  It was probably helped by the fact that the beginning strings section is not using bows yet and we were spared the sound of 30+ cats being tortured.

3.  Even when it sucks, running has been great lately.  I’m not fast, but I’m faster.  My endurance is slowly coming back.  Nothing hurts.  This may just possibly be affecting my thinking process.  I may have tweeted yesterday about doing 12 half marathons in 2012.  There may be thoughts of a very late fall marathon running through my head.  There may be significant progress made on my 50 states goal.  Last night I was a bit like an ADD rabbit on speed looking at race sites, completely unable to narrow down my goals.  Sadly though, my life doesn’t exist in a vacuum.  I have budget constraints, time constraints, and, oh yeah, two kids.  So, sometime in the next couple of weeks, I’ll start penciling in my race calendar for 2012, which will be busy and challenging, is not likely to be as crazy as it was last night.
